Question:
Eight fluid ounces (1 qt = 32 oz) of a beverage in a glass at 18.0°C is to be cooled by adding ice and stirring. The properties of the beverage may be taken to be those of Liquid water. The enthalpy of the ice relative to liquid water at the triple point is – 348kJ/kg. Estimate the mass of ice (g) that must melt to bring the liquid temperature to 4°C, neglecting energy losses to the surroundings. (Note: For this isobaric batch process. the energy balance reduces to Q = ΔH.)
